FIFA 2007 DS

FIFA has all the fundamentals required for a great game: a wide choice of fully statistically modelled teams, a hatful of modes, off-the-field options, and some nice homegrown DS-tailored features. Okay, it doesn't play beautiful-looking football. But while cultured fans brought up on Champions League contenders will wince, the truth is FIFA 07 on DS is far from unplayable. In fact, in many ways it's actually quite effective.
